Trivia about the song Eternally by Sarah Vaughan

When was the song “Eternally” released by Sarah Vaughan?
The song Eternally was released in 1961, on the album “My Heart Sings”.
Who composed the song “Eternally” by Sarah Vaughan?
The song “Eternally” by Sarah Vaughan was composed by Charlie Chaplin, Geoff Parsons, and George Benson.
